More People Die After Smoking Drugs Than Injecting Them

0
32


NEW YORK — Smoking has surpassed injecting as the most typical means of taking medication in U.S. overdose deaths, a brand new authorities study suggests.

The Facilities for Illness Management and Prevention known as its research revealed Thursday the biggest to have a look at how People took the medication that killed them.

CDC officers determined to review the subject after seeing stories from California suggesting that smoking fentanyl was changing into extra widespread than injecting it. Potent, illicit variations of the painkiller are concerned in additional U.S. overdose deaths than every other drug.

Some early analysis has instructed that smoking fentanyl is considerably much less lethal than injecting it, and any discount in injection-related overdose deaths is a constructive, stated the research’s lead creator, Lauren Tanz.

However “each injection and smoking carry a considerable overdose danger,” and it’s not but clear if a shift towards smoking fentanyl reduces U.S. overdose deaths, stated Tanz, a CDC scientist who research overdoses.

Illicit fentanyl is an infamously highly effective drug that, in powder kind, more and more has been minimize into heroin or different medication. In recent times, it has been a major driver of the U.S. overdose epidemic. Drug overdose deaths within the U.S. went up barely in 2022 after two huge leaps through the pandemic, and provisional information for the primary 9 months of 2023 suggests it inched up final 12 months.

For years, fentanyl has primarily been injected, however drug customers have more and more smoked it. Individuals put the powder on tin foil or in a glass pipe, heated from under, and inhale the vapor, defined Alex Karl, a RTI Worldwide researcher who research drug customers in San Francisco.

Smoked fentanyl is just not as concentrated as fentanyl in a syringe, however some drug-takers see upsides to smoking, Kral stated. Amongst them: Individuals who inject usually take care of pus-filled abscesses on their pores and skin and danger infections with hepatitis and different ailments.

“One particular person confirmed me his arms and stated, ‘Hey, have a look at my arm! It appears stunning! I can now put on T-shirts and I can get a job as a result of I haven’t got these monitor marks,'” Kral stated.

CDC investigators studied the development by utilizing a nationwide database constructed from dying certificates, toxicology stories and stories from coroners and health workers.

They have been in a position to get appropriate information from the District of Columbia and 27 states for the years 2020 to 2022. From these locations, they received info on how medication have been taken in about 71,000 of the greater than 311,000 whole U.S. overdose deaths over these three years—or about 23%.

The researchers discovered that between early 2020 and late 2022, the share of overdose deaths with proof of smoking rose 74% whereas the share of deaths with proof of injection fell 29%. The quantity and proportion of deaths with proof of snorting additionally elevated, although not as dramatically as smoking-related deaths, the research discovered.

It’s difficult to map out precise percentages of deaths that occurred after smoking, injecting, snorting, or swallowing medication, specialists say. In some circumstances an individual could have used a number of medication, taken alternative ways. In different circumstances, no drug-taking methodology was recognized.

The research discovered that in late 2022, of the deaths for which a way was recognized, 23% of the deaths occurred after smoking, 16% after injections, 16% after snorting, and 14.5% after swallowing.

Tanz stated she feels the information is nationally consultant. Information got here from states from each area of the nation, and all confirmed will increase in smoking and reduces in injecting. Smoking was the most typical route within the West and Midwest, and roughly tied with injecting within the Northeast and South, the report stated.

Kral described the research as “largely good” however stated it has limitations.

It may be tough to establish the how and why of an overdose dying, particularly if no witness was current. Injections could be extra generally reported due to injection marks on the physique; to detect smoking “they possible would want to discover a pipe or foil on the scene and determine whether or not to write down that down,” he stated.

Kral additionally famous that many individuals who smoke fentanyl use a straw to inhale vapors from the burning powder, and it is potential investigators noticed a straw and assumed it was snorted.
